Supreme Court Justices Legal Authority Appointed By President
The Supreme Court of the United States is the highest legal authority in the country and the Supreme Court Justices are appointed by the President himself. The panel of judges consists of a Chief Justice and eight Associate Justices who are responsible for the operations of the judicial system across the country.

Constitution System Of Fundamental Written And Unwritten Laws
Constitution is the system of fundamental laws and principals that prescribes the nature, functions and limits of the government or another institution. It must be documented and recorded. In Western Democratic theory, it is a mandate from the people in their sovereign capacity concerning how they shall be governed. It gives certain rights to the people. The existence of the constitution implies there are some restrains upon those who govern.

Wisconsin Circuit Court Biggest Trial Court In County Of Milwaukee
A Wisconsin Circuit court is a trial court of the state of Wisconsin. The circuit courts worked as one-level trail courts in Wisconsin in 1978.A circuit court is made up of branches. There is a minimum of one branch in a county. There are six counties that are in pairs and they have common judges. There are at present 241 circuit court judges at Wisconsin.
